Mirador de la Gola sud The mouth of the Mijares River is part of a wetland declared as a protected area. The Mijares River is the most important river in the province of Castellón, both in terms of flow and length. The mouth is formed by an alluvial cone, closed superficially by a gravel cord The path is designed for non-motorized uses, mainly walkers and cyclists

During the Civil War from 1930 to 1939, a large part of a huge line of trenches, bunkers, machine gun nests, magazines was excavated in Espadán, with which the Republican Army defended the city of Valencia during the war offensive. Along the route you can visit some of these defenses

Yes, a significant geological formation is Peñas Aragonesas, located within the Sierra de Espadán natural park. It is known for its unique pyramidal-shaped rock formations and striking red sandstone cliffs with vertical cuts from erosion.
For impressive panoramic views, consider Pic de la Font de Cabres, which provides expansive vistas of the coast and the valleys of the Plana Baixa. Another excellent spot is Creu del Ferro Summit, offering some of the best views of the region and the orange blossom coast.

Yes, Nules Pond is a family-friendly natural monument. It's an interesting 'estany' that houses diverse poultry fauna, with benches and shade for resting. It also features picnic tables, making it suitable for a family outing. The Mouth of the Mijares River is also considered family-friendly, offering a path designed for walkers and cyclists.
The region's orange groves offer a unique sensory experience, especially during blooming season (typically spring) or when the fruit is ripe (late autumn to winter). For hiking and outdoor activities, spring and autumn generally provide pleasant temperatures. Summers can be hot, while winters are mild.
Yes, Creu del Ferro Summit offers more than just views. It features historical elements from the Civil War, including trenches, bunkers, and machine gun nests that were part of the Republican Army's defenses.
Absolutely. Nules Pond is known for its abundant ornithological fauna, including ducks and cormorants, making it an excellent spot for birdwatching. The Mouth of the Mijares River is also part of a protected wetland, which supports diverse birdlife.
